What increased rotational speed to 8500 rpm /min in Vega 5200-R gives me in practice?

In the world of combustion saws, rotational speed is the key to clean and efficient cutting. The higher the rotation, the faster the chain cutting teeth move through the wood structure. At 8500 rpm. /min Vega 5200-R saw does not tug on fibers, but cuts them with surgical smoothness. In practice, this means that you do not have to press the saw to the trunk – the gravity of the machine itself combined with such a gigantic speed makes the cutting system literally "sink" into the wood, which dramatically speeds up your work and saves strength.

How does a diaphragm carburetor cope with working in difficult positions and how is it different from the classic?

Classic float carburetors (known from older vehicles or simple machines) work correctly only when the device stands straight. Tilting it cuts off the fuel supply. The Vega 5200-R uses a professional diaphragm carburetor, in which the dosage of fuel is responsible for a flexible membrane reacting to vacuum in the engine carter. Thanks to this, whether you are knocking down a tree right next to the ground holding the saw sideways or cutting off branches overhead, fuel is fed with constant, ideal pressure.

How to properly care for the air filter and cooling system with such a powerful engine?

At a speed of 8500 rpm. /min and cutting dry wood generate huge amounts of fine dust and chips. To maintain full power of 2,1 kW, the engine must breathe freely. You should regularly (preferably after each harder day of work) remove the top cover and clean the air filter (shake or wash in warm soapy water). It is equally important to clean the cooling ribs on the cylinder and around the flywheel – the sawdust lying there acts as a thermal insulator, which with such an effortd engine could lead to its overheating.
